1. Function1. Ornamental decoration: The leaves of the green radish are evergreen all the year round, and it is very easy to cultivate and grow out of the pot, so growing it at home can not only allow people to appreciate it, but also serve as a home decoration. The plant also has a certain climbing ability. After being fixed, it can climb the wall. 2. Purification effect: This plant has a good purification effect. It can absorb benzene, trichloroethylene and other gases that are harmful to the human body in the room. It is very suitable for maintenance in a newly renovated house. Moreover, it can absorb oil smoke and some odors very well. 2. Can it absorb formaldehyde?Green ivy can absorb formaldehyde and has a good purification effect. However, if you want to remove the formaldehyde content in the house, you cannot rely solely on green ivy to remove it. You should open the windows more often to ensure good air circulation. Plants can only play an auxiliary role in absorbing formaldehyde. 3. NotesAlthough there are many benefits to growing green radish, you should also be aware that its juice is toxic. If you keep it at home, you should avoid skin contact and it should not be eaten. Although it has medicinal value, do not consume it casually. Especially if there are infants and young children at home, you should pay more attention. |
